Dan Reinbold is a seasoned executive with over 20 years of experience in the Information Technology sector, currently serving as the Vice President of Information Services at Plains Midstream Canada. In this pivotal role, Dan is at the forefront of integrating the Information Services (IS) organizations of Plains All American and Plains Midstream Canada, creating a unified department that enhances operational efficiency across all North American locations. His leadership is instrumental in driving the convergence of Information Services, Operational Technology, and Digital Transformation initiatives, ensuring that Plains remains competitive in a rapidly evolving energy landscape.
